Interesting facts and trivia about Lost In Japan. By Songfacts®.

This soulful boogie was released as the second single from Shawn Mendes' third album just at the stroke of midnight on March 23, 2018. Do you got plans tonight? I'm a couple hundred miles from Japan And I was thinking I could fly to your hotel tonight Cause I can't get you off my mind Shawn is ready to fly across the seas to be closer to his love interest.

Mendes revealed to Billboard. that "Lost In Japan" was inspired by a night time slumber. "I had this dream that I was lost in this country," he said, "and I woke up the next day and we had this cool piano part and the song was birthed."

The song incorporates bouncy R&B beats and funky melodies, which Shawn said was inspired by all of the Justin Timberlake music he was listening to at the time.
